Tibetan Tsa Tsa boxes, integral to Tibetan Buddhism, represent not just artistic expression but also profound spiritual significance. These small molds are used to create Tsa Tsa, miniature clay or plaster images of deities, particularly of the Buddha. The practice of making and using Tsa Tsa has deep historical roots and is rich in cultural meaning, playing a vital role in spiritual practice and community devotion.
Historical Background
The tradition of Tsa Tsa dates back to ancient Tibetan Buddhist practices, where creating these small statues served as a form of merit-making. Monks and lay practitioners alike have engaged in this art, believing that producing Tsa Tsa contributes to one’s spiritual growth and accumulates positive karma. Historically, Tsa Tsa were often made in remembrance of deceased loved ones, serving as a way to honor their spirits and aid in their journey in the afterlife.
These artifacts also serve as reminders of the impermanence of life, encouraging practitioners to focus on their spiritual path and the importance of compassion, mindfulness, and dedication. As such, Tsa Tsa boxes have transcended mere decorative items; they are essential tools for spiritual practice and community bonding.

Role in Spiritual Practice and Enhancement
In spiritual practice, Tsa Tsa boxes are invaluable. They serve multiple purposes:
-
Meditative Focus: Creating Tsa Tsa can be a meditative practice in itself, allowing practitioners to cultivate mindfulness and concentration. The process encourages a deep connection to the divine while channeling positive energy.
-
Merit Accumulation: Making Tsa Tsa is seen as an act of generosity and compassion. Each Tsa Tsa produced is believed to generate merit, which can be dedicated to oneself or others, aiding in spiritual progress.
-
Remembrance and Healing: Tsa Tsa boxes often hold special significance for those wishing to remember loved ones. The act of creating and placing Tsa Tsa serves as a healing practice, providing solace and a way to connect spiritually with those who have passed.
-
Enhancing Personal Practice: Many practitioners keep Tsa Tsa at home or in meditation spaces to enhance their spiritual atmosphere. The presence of these sacred images can uplift one’s energy and intention during practice.
